Team’s Up – Brendan names full strength Celts for Final

Brendan Rodgers has named his Celtic team for this afternoon’s Scottish Cup Final against Rangers. After lifting the Premiership trophy last weekend, the Scottish Champions will be looking to add another piece of silverware to their trophy cabinet.

The manager has picked the same team that beat Rangers two weeks ago after making six changes last weekend.

In goals, Joe Hart starts for the final time as Celtic No.1. The Englishman will be hoping to add another honour as he brings down the curtain on a glittering career.

In defence, Liam Scales partners Cameron Carter-Vickers in the central pairing with Alistair Johnston and Greg Taylor in the fullback berths.

In midfield, Callum McGregor skippers the side with Matt O’Riley and Reo Hatate.

In attack, Kyogo leads the line with James Forrest and Daizen Maeda start in the wide areas.

On the bench: Scott Bain, Tony Ralston, Maik Nawrocki, Stephen Welsh, Paulo Bernardo, Tomoki Iwata, Luis Palma, Nicolas Kuhn, Adam Idah.
